This is Aton's second attempt at a deal, following the German investor's failed approach in 2016.
M&R has since rejected the offer, saying it undervalued the company, citing an independent report which determined a fair offer of R20-R22 per share.
While PIC is not supporting the bid, Aton has since acquired shares from two of M&R's top 10 shareholders, one of which is Allan Gray. Aton's stake in M&R currently stands at 39.8%.
